Help: sort data and move to a new sheet
I have a list of students names in columns with their run time and
other physical tests along the row. The sheet uses a vlookup table to calculate their scores and from their scores, determines if they pass or fail and if they pass, if they are to receive a fitness pin "Y". There are columns for each fitness test, a column for their final score, a column for "Y" or "N" for a fitness pin and a column for "P"ass or "F"ail. I would like to copy from the main sheet to another sheet (for printing) all those students who passed "P" and all those students who received a fitness pin (either separate new sheets or the same new one) How can I do this? HELP... -Michael |

sort data and move to a new sheet
Hi DyverDown
You can use AutoFilter on the P/F ccolumn and print Or if you want a seperate sheet see http://www.rondebruin.nl/copy5.htm -- Regards Ron de Bruin http://www.rondebruin.nl/tips.htm "DyverDown" wrote in message ups.com...
